The time delay that is unavoidable due to mechanical switch processes, for example, can be
adapted via parameters. p9850/p9650 specifies the tolerance time within which
selection/deselection of the two monitoring channels must take place to be considered as
"simultaneous".
Note
In order to avoid that faults are incorrectly initiated, on these inputs the tolerance time must
always be set shorter than the shortest time between two switching events (ON/OFF,
OFF/ON).
If the "Safe Torque Off" function is not selected/deselected within the tolerance time, this is
detected by the cross-comparison, and fault F01611 or F30611 (STOP F) is output. In this
case, the pulses have already been canceled as a result of the selection of "Safe Torque
Off" on one channel.

Bit pattern test

Bit pattern test of fail-safe outputs
The inverter normally responds immediately to signal changes in its fail-safe inputs. This is
not desired in the following case: Several control modules test their fail-safe outputs using bit
pattern tests (on/off tests) to identify faults due to either short or cross circuiting. When you
interconnect a fail-safe input of the inverter with a fail-safe output of a control module, the
inverter responds to these test signals.
